One-Pan Garlic Prawns & Mixed Vegetables
 One-Pan Garlic Olive Oil Prawns & Mixed Vegetables 
Savour the simplicity with this no-fuss, flavour-packed one-pan meal. It’s all about fresh ingredients, a sprinkle of herbs, and the natural goodness of prawns and vegetables. Healthy eating has never tasted so good!
Ingredients:
        •       Prawns (400g, shelled and deveined)
        •       Asparagus (250g, ends trimmed)
        •       Cherry tomatoes (150g, halved)
        •       Courgettes (1, sliced)
        •       Olive oil (3 tbsp)
        •       Garlic (4 cloves, minced)
        •       Lemon (juiced and zested)
        •       Salt and pepper (to taste)
        •       Fresh parsley, basil, and thyme (chopped)
Method:
        1.      Prep: Season prawns with salt, pepper, and half the lemon zest.
        2.      Prawns: Heat 2 tbsp olive oil in a pan over medium heat. Cook prawns until pink (2-3 min per side). Set aside.
        3.      Veggies: In the same pan, add remaining oil. Sauté garlic, then add asparagus, tomatoes, courgettes, and thyme. Cook till tender-crisp.
        4.      Combine: Add prawns back to the pan with basil, remaining zest, and lemon juice.
        5.      Garnish: Sprinkle with parsley and serve immediately.
